Autopilot

AP Abbreviation · automatic pilot Synonym

An automatic flight-control function that commands aircraft controls to follow selected guidance or stabilize flight.

TECHNICAL EXPLANATION

What it means technically

Maintenance troubleshooting considers sensors, data buses, servos, flight-control computers, mode logic and cockpit controls.

FULL CONTEXT

How the term is used

The autopilot uses flight-guidance commands, attitude and air-data inputs, control computers and actuators. Modes and engagement criteria vary by aircraft.

MAINTENANCE CONTEXT

Where you may encounter it

Technicians perform approved operational tests and verify correct mode annunciation after relevant work.

Safety and misunderstanding note

An autopilot fault can be caused by another system input; replacing the obvious control unit may not address the root cause.
